Time course of the mRNA expression in wild-type Thermus thermophilus HB8 strain grown on a rich medium (labeling:ENZO)


ABSTRACT: We observed the expression profile of the total mRNA of wild-type Thermus thermophilus HB8 strain grown in a rich (TT) medium at 70oC. Keywords: time course Three wild-type T. thermophilus HB8 strains were pre-cultured at 70oC for 16 h in 3 ml of TT medium containing 0.8% polypeptone, 0.4% yeast extract, 0.2% NaCl, 0.4 mM CaCl2, and 0.4 mM MgCl2, which was adjusted to pH 7.2 with NaOH. The cells (2 ml) were inoculated into 1 liter of the same medium and then cultivated at 70oC. Cells were collected after 180, 240, 300, 360, 420, 480, 540, 600, 680, and 760 min, and then crude RNA was extracted. The expression of each mRNA at each time point was analyzed on a GeneChip as described under Sample Description Sheet of each sample in this website.

Transcription activation mediated by a cyclic AMP receptor protein from Thermus thermophilus HB8.

Shinkai Akeo A   Kira Satoshi S   Nakagawa Noriko N   Kashihara Aiko A   Kuramitsu Seiki S   Yokoyama Shigeyuki S  

Journal of bacteriology 20070316 10


The extremely thermophilic bacterium Thermus thermophilus HB8, which belongs to the phylum Deinococcus-Thermus, has an open reading frame encoding a protein belonging to the cyclic AMP (cAMP) receptor protein (CRP) family present in many bacteria. The protein named T. thermophilus CRP is highly homologous to the CRP family proteins from the phyla Firmicutes, Actinobacteria, and Cyanobacteria, and it forms a homodimer and interacts with cAMP.
